Advanced Hair Repair Technologies for Damaged Hair

Hair damage from styling, environmental stressors, and chemical treatments is a common concern, but the latest advancements in hair repair technology offer new hope. Innovative treatments now focus on not just superficial fixes but on deep, cellular repair, revitalizing hair from the inside out.

Recent breakthroughs include the development of bond-building molecules that work within the hair shaft to restore structural integrity and strength. These molecules, similar to those naturally found in healthy hair, reconnect broken disulfide bonds caused by chemical processes or heat styling.

Moreover, encapsulation technologies have emerged, allowing active ingredients to be delivered directly to where they are most needed, ensuring prolonged and targeted repair. These technologies work in tandem with natural oils and proteins, which coat and protect the hair, sealing in moisture and nutrients.

The Science of Cellular Repair: Bond-Building Molecules

One of the most groundbreaking advancements in haircare is the development of bond-building molecules, which target structural damage at the cellular level. Chemical treatments, such as coloring or perming, break down the hair’s disulfide bonds—the protein chains responsible for its strength and elasticity. Research shows that 62% of chemically treated hair loses 30% of its natural tensile strength within six months.

Bond-building technologies, like those pioneered by XJ Beauty, use molecules structurally identical to those found in healthy hair (e.g., cysteic acid and amino acids) to reconnect these broken bonds. Clinical trials reveal that products infused with these molecules improve hair strength by up to 45% after four weeks of use. Encapsulation Technology: Precision Delivery for Lasting Repair

Traditional haircare products often struggle to penetrate the hair shaft deeply. Encapsulation technologies solve this by encasing active ingredients (e.g., keratin, ceramides) in microscopic carriers that release nutrients directly into the cortex—the hair’s innermost layer. A 2024 study published in Cosmetics & Toiletries demonstrated that encapsulation boosts ingredient efficacy by 70% compared to non-encapsulated formulas.

Natural Oils and Proteins: Synergy with Advanced Science

While synthetic technologies dominate headlines, natural ingredients remain indispensable. Oils like marula and baobab, rich in omega fatty acids, restore lipid layers damaged by UV rays and pollution. When combined with plant-derived proteins (e.g., quinoa, wheat), these ingredients enhance hair’s moisture retention by up to 50%, as shown in a 2023 NIH study on keratin-based treatments.
